Kristen Stewart and Robert Pattinson began dating around 2009, after meeting and working together on the "Twilight" movie series, where they played love interests. They kept much of their relationship private initially, with Stewart publicly confirming they were a couple in a 2011 interview. Their relationship lasted on and off until they officially broke up in 2013. Despite their breakup, their relationship was a defining moment of early 2010s celebrity culture, marked by intense media attention especially after 2012 when Stewart was photographed kissing another person, which led to a temporary break and brief reconciliation before their final split in 2013.
